* [devel] undefined symbol: pthread_attr_getstacksize
@ 2009-11-11 14:03 Denis Kirienko
2009-11-11 14:06 ` Led
2009-11-11 14:20 ` Dmitry V. Levin
0 siblings, 2 replies; 10+ messages in thread
From: Denis Kirienko @ 2009-11-11 14:03 UTC (permalink / raw)
To: ALT Linux Team development discussions
Добрый день!
Пытаюсь собрать компилятор google go, при сборке получаю такую ошибку:
./fib: symbol lookup error: /home/dk/go/pkg/linux_386/libcgo.so:
undefined symbol: pthread_attr_getstacksize
Кто-нибудь может помочь?
--
Денис
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-11 14:03 [devel] undefined symbol: pthread_attr_getstacksize Denis Kirienko
@ 2009-11-11 14:06 ` Led
2009-11-11 15:14 ` Denis Kirienko
2009-11-11 14:20 ` Dmitry V. Levin
1 sibling, 1 reply; 10+ messages in thread
From: Led @ 2009-11-11 14:06 UTC (permalink / raw)
To: ALT Linux Team development discussions
On Wednesday 11 November 2009 16:03:37 Denis Kirienko wrote:
> Добрый день!
>
> Пытаюсь собрать компилятор google go, при сборке получаю такую ошибку:
>
> ./fib: symbol lookup error: /home/dk/go/pkg/linux_386/libcgo.so:
> undefined symbol: pthread_attr_getstacksize
>
> Кто-нибудь может помочь?
apt-get install glibc-devel
--
Led
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-11 14:03 [devel] undefined symbol: pthread_attr_getstacksize Denis Kirienko
2009-11-11 14:06 ` Led
@ 2009-11-11 14:20 ` Dmitry V. Levin
2009-11-11 15:21 ` Denis Kirienko
1 sibling, 1 reply; 10+ messages in thread
From: Dmitry V. Levin @ 2009-11-11 14:20 UTC (permalink / raw)
To: ALT Linux Team development discussions
[-- Attachment #1: Type: text/plain, Size: 419 bytes --]
Hi,
On Wed, Nov 11, 2009 at 05:03:37PM +0300, Denis Kirienko wrote:
>
> Пытаюсь собрать компилятор google go, при сборке получаю такую ошибку:
>
> ./fib: symbol lookup error: /home/dk/go/pkg/linux_386/libcgo.so:
> undefined symbol: pthread_attr_getstacksize
>
> Кто-нибудь может помочь?
This symbol is provided by glibc-pthread, so it looks like an incarnation
of the --as-needed issue.
--
ldv
[-- Attachment #2: Type: application/pgp-signature, Size: 198 bytes --]
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-11 14:06 ` Led
@ 2009-11-11 15:14 ` Denis Kirienko
0 siblings, 0 replies; 10+ messages in thread
From: Denis Kirienko @ 2009-11-11 15:14 UTC (permalink / raw)
To: devel
11.11.2009 17:06, Led пишет:
>> Кто-нибудь может помочь?
>
> apt-get install glibc-devel
Ну разумеется не в таких пустяках дело...
--
Денис
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-11 14:20 ` Dmitry V. Levin
@ 2009-11-11 15:21 ` Denis Kirienko
2009-11-11 15:30 ` Led
2009-11-12 8:00 ` Stanislav Ievlev
0 siblings, 2 replies; 10+ messages in thread
From: Denis Kirienko @ 2009-11-11 15:21 UTC (permalink / raw)
To: devel
11.11.2009 17:20, Dmitry V. Levin пишет:
>> ./fib: symbol lookup error: /home/dk/go/pkg/linux_386/libcgo.so:
>> undefined symbol: pthread_attr_getstacksize
>>
>> Кто-нибудь может помочь?
>
> This symbol is provided by glibc-pthread, so it looks like an incarnation
> of the --as-needed issue.
Не очень понял, что с этим делать, но на самом деле сам go собирается.
Проблемы возникают, при попытке собрать "a trivial example of wrapping a
C library in Go".
В общем, это уже не столь важно.
--
Денис
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-11 15:21 ` Denis Kirienko
@ 2009-11-11 15:30 ` Led
2009-11-11 15:54 ` Denis Kirienko
2009-11-12 8:00 ` Stanislav Ievlev
1 sibling, 1 reply; 10+ messages in thread
From: Led @ 2009-11-11 15:30 UTC (permalink / raw)
To: ALT Linux Team development discussions
On Wednesday 11 November 2009 17:21:57 Denis Kirienko wrote:
> 11.11.2009 17:20, Dmitry V. Levin пишет:
> >> ./fib: symbol lookup error: /home/dk/go/pkg/linux_386/libcgo.so:
> >> undefined symbol: pthread_attr_getstacksize
> >>
> >> Кто-нибудь может помочь?
> >
> > This symbol is provided by glibc-pthread, so it looks like an incarnation
> > of the --as-needed issue.
>
> Не очень понял, что с этим делать, но на самом деле сам go собирается.
>
> Проблемы возникают, при попытке собрать "a trivial example of wrapping a
> C library in Go".
>
> В общем, это уже не столь важно.
>
Да собирается там всё. Нужно только в двух местах немножко линковку
подправить.
--
Led
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-11 15:30 ` Led
@ 2009-11-11 15:54 ` Denis Kirienko
0 siblings, 0 replies; 10+ messages in thread
From: Denis Kirienko @ 2009-11-11 15:54 UTC (permalink / raw)
To: devel
11.11.2009 18:30, Led пишет:
> Да собирается там всё. Нужно только в двух местах немножко линковку
> подправить.
А можно подробней? А лучше - пакет в Сизиф.
--
Денис
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-11 15:21 ` Denis Kirienko
2009-11-11 15:30 ` Led
@ 2009-11-12 8:00 ` Stanislav Ievlev
2009-11-12 10:00 ` Denis Kirienko
1 sibling, 1 reply; 10+ messages in thread
From: Stanislav Ievlev @ 2009-11-12 8:00 UTC (permalink / raw)
To: ALT Linux Team development discussions
11 ноября 2009 г. 18:21 пользователь Denis Kirienko <dk@altlinux.ru> написал:
> 11.11.2009 17:20, Dmitry V. Levin пишет:
>
>>> ./fib: symbol lookup error: /home/dk/go/pkg/linux_386/libcgo.so:
>>> undefined symbol: pthread_attr_getstacksize
>>>
>>> Кто-нибудь может помочь?
>>
>> This symbol is provided by glibc-pthread, so it looks like an incarnation
>> of the --as-needed issue.
>
> Не очень понял, что с этим делать, но на самом деле сам go собирается.
>
> Проблемы возникают, при попытке собрать "a trivial example of wrapping a
> C library in Go".
>
> В общем, это уже не столь важно.
Библиотека недолинкована с pthread, поэтому все примеры не
компилируются. Исправление - тривиальный фикс в сборке этого go.
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-12 8:00 ` Stanislav Ievlev
@ 2009-11-12 10:00 ` Denis Kirienko
2009-11-12 10:34 ` Stanislav Ievlev
0 siblings, 1 reply; 10+ messages in thread
From: Denis Kirienko @ 2009-11-12 10:00 UTC (permalink / raw)
To: devel
12.11.2009 11:00, Stanislav Ievlev пишет:
>> Проблемы возникают, при попытке собрать "a trivial example of wrapping a
>> C library in Go".
>>
>> В общем, это уже не столь важно.
>
> Библиотека недолинкована с pthread, поэтому все примеры не
> компилируются. Исправление - тривиальный фикс в сборке этого go.
Мне слабо такой фикс сделать, или, наверное, для меня это будет уже
нетривиально.
--
Денис
^ permalink raw reply [flat|nested] 10+ messages in thread
* Re: [devel] undefined symbol: pthread_attr_getstacksize
2009-11-12 10:00 ` Denis Kirienko
@ 2009-11-12 10:34 ` Stanislav Ievlev
0 siblings, 0 replies; 10+ messages in thread
From: Stanislav Ievlev @ 2009-11-12 10:34 UTC (permalink / raw)
To: ALT Linux Team development discussions
12 ноября 2009 г. 13:00 пользователь Denis Kirienko <dk@altlinux.ru> написал:
> 12.11.2009 11:00, Stanislav Ievlev пишет:
>
>>> Проблемы возникают, при попытке собрать "a trivial example of wrapping a
>>> C library in Go".
>>>
>>> В общем, это уже не столь важно.
>>
>> Библиотека недолинкована с pthread, поэтому все примеры не
>> компилируются. Исправление - тривиальный фикс в сборке этого go.
>
> Мне слабо такой фикс сделать, или, наверное, для меня это будет уже
> нетривиально.
Слишком плохо о себе думаете ;)
Просто найдите где там в собирается библиотека и добавьте -lpthread ;)
^ permalink raw reply [flat|nested] 10+ messages in thread
end of thread, other threads:[~2009-11-12 10:34 UTC | newest]
Thread overview: 10+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2009-11-11 14:03 [devel] undefined symbol: pthread_attr_getstacksize Denis Kirienko
2009-11-11 14:06 ` Led
2009-11-11 15:14 ` Denis Kirienko
2009-11-11 14:20 ` Dmitry V. Levin
2009-11-11 15:21 ` Denis Kirienko
2009-11-11 15:30 ` Led
2009-11-11 15:54 ` Denis Kirienko
2009-11-12 8:00 ` Stanislav Ievlev
2009-11-12 10:00 ` Denis Kirienko
2009-11-12 10:34 ` Stanislav Ievlev
ALT Linux Team development discussions
This inbox may be cloned and mirrored by anyone:
git clone --mirror http://lore.altlinux.org/devel/0 devel/git/0.git
# If you have public-inbox 1.1+ installed, you may
# initialize and index your mirror using the following commands:
public-inbox-init -V2 devel devel/ http://lore.altlinux.org/devel \
devel@altlinux.org devel@altlinux.ru devel@lists.altlinux.org devel@lists.altlinux.ru devel@linux.iplabs.ru mandrake-russian@linuxteam.iplabs.ru sisyphus@linuxteam.iplabs.ru
public-inbox-index devel
Example config snippet for mirrors.
Newsgroup available over NNTP:
nntp://lore.altlinux.org/org.altlinux.lists.devel
AGPL code for this site: git clone https://public-inbox.org/public-inbox.git